Anti-indie Prejudices

Last time I wrote about Awards And Prejudice, touching on the misunderstandings that are sometimes applied to independent authors and their work. The means of production doesn’t relate to the quality of the output: only the author and the reading experience matter. Thankfully that bias is rapidly fading away as facts show how unsubstantiated those opinions are, and how the views reveal (as always) more about the prejudices of the speaker than the reality.
